Nursing Informatics Topics

The following list is a partial list of open online courses material at Georgetown University School of Nursing and Health Studies.  These material can be incorporated into your course.  For each topic, there is a lecture, a related laboratory where students are demonstrated how to do the assignment and a test that usually constitutes 10% of the student's grade in the course. 

This list is based on Essential IV: Information Management and Application of Patient Care Technology developed by Revision of The Essentials of Baccalaureate Education for Professional Nursing Practice August 18, 2008
